The Career Advancement Programme in Compassionate Relationships is designed to equip participants with the essential skills and knowledge to excel in roles requiring emotional intelligence and empathy. This program focuses on building strong, healthy relationships within a professional context, enhancing leadership capabilities and promoting a positive and productive work environment.
Learning outcomes include improved communication skills, conflict resolution strategies, effective teamwork, and enhanced leadership capabilities within a compassionate framework. Participants will develop a deeper understanding of emotional intelligence and its application in the workplace, leading to more effective collaborations and improved interpersonal relationships. The programme also explores ethical considerations and best practices in professional settings.
The duration of the Career Advancement Programme in Compassionate Relationships is typically six months, delivered through a flexible blend of online modules, workshops, and mentoring sessions. This allows participants to integrate learning into their existing professional lives. The flexible structure caters to professionals in various sectors who want to invest in their professional development.
This programme holds significant industry relevance across numerous sectors, including healthcare, education, human resources, social work, and non-profit organizations. Skills in compassionate leadership and relationship management are highly sought after across diverse fields and this training provides a competitive edge in today's dynamic work landscape. Successful completion leads to certification in compassionate leadership and relationship management.

Why this course?
Career Advancement Programmes are increasingly significant in fostering compassionate relationships within today's competitive UK market. The demand for emotionally intelligent leadership is soaring, with a recent CIPD report suggesting that 70% of UK employers value empathy and compassion in their workforce. This translates to a clear need for structured programmes focused on developing these crucial soft skills alongside technical expertise. A 2022 study by the Institute for Employment Studies found that businesses with strong compassionate cultures experienced a 25% reduction in employee turnover. This underscores the direct link between investment in career development and improved employee retention.
